Liverpool is reportedly pursuing several players targeted by Newcastle United, intensifying their transfer rivalry. Last summer, Liverpool signed Alexander Isak and Hugo Ekitike from Newcastle, and this summer they have activated Victor Munoz's release clause, a player Newcastle sought to replace Anthony Gordon. This trend has generated significant backlash among Newcastle fans on social media as they scramble to find alternatives. Additionally, both clubs are interested in Lamine Camara, among other prospects, indicating ongoing competition for key targets.
